Transaction 43a343e406e4b1544ae244c16b3a2213a57de31d055103eb2605e859d44e1021
1 Input
2 Outputs
- 43a343e406e4b1544ae244c16b3a2213a57de31d055103eb2605e859d44e1021:0
- 43a343e406e4b1544ae244c16b3a2213a57de31d055103eb2605e859d44e1021:1
value 1879771777
address 16RJ75C5PPZZaUHcbAhSKFde5gjAAxVS6p
value 1402942
address 3HJw2kPZdmxWfZssPwowKjyfr77KtXFMrc